One area of concern is the increasing use of AI-powered cameras, such as those produced by Ring, which have been criticized for their potential to track individuals. According to leaked emails, Ring's CEO, Jamie Siminoff, has expressed interest in using the company's cameras to identify specific individuals, sparking fears about the erosion of privacy. This development has led to renewed calls for greater transparency and regulation in the use of AI-powered surveillance systems.
On the other hand, Microsoft has made significant strides in developing a revolutionary data storage system that can last for millennia. The company's glass storage method uses a high-energy laser to imprint deformations into a 3D chunk of borosilicate glass, allowing for the storage of vast amounts of data. This technology has the potential to solve the problem of long-term data preservation, which is a significant challenge in the digital age.
